I have a fresh 383 stroker from west coast engines. Alum heads, roller cam and rockers. Here are the specs.

Horsepower: 450-475
Torque: 450 lbs
Gas: 91 Octane (Premium Unleaded Gas)
Max RPM: Idle to 5500 RPM
Stall Recommended: 2300-2500
Crankshaft: Scat (Steel)
Cylinder Heads: R.P.C. / ProMaxx Aluminum (64cc/195cc)
Cylinder Head Gasket: Fel-Pro
Cylinder Head Bolts: Elgin
Valve Springs: Pioneer
Lifters: COMP Cams
Valve Size: 2.02/1.60
Camshaft: COMP Cams / Trick-Flow
Camshaft Lift: .540”
Camshaft Duration: 230° Int / 234° Exh. @ .050” Lift
Camshaft Lobe Separation: 110
Vacuum at Idle: 16″
Push Rods: COMP Cams
Rockers: Elgin SSR (1.5 Roller Rocker)
Rocker Arm Stud: ARP
Intake Manifold: Edelbrock Performer RPM (Aluminum)
Pistons: Federal Mogul (Hypereutectic)
Piston Rings: Federal Mogul (Moly)
Connecting Rods: GM Forged Powder Metal
Timing Set: Melling (HD Roller)
Bearings: KING HP Series (Tri-Metal Performance)
